A surfactant-free and template-free method for the high-yield synthesis of biomolecule (serotonin)based formaldehyde resin (BFR) microspheres is proposed for the first time. The colloidal microspheres loaded with Au nanoparticles (AuNPs) prepared by a convenient in-situ synthesis of AuNPs on BEA (AuNPs/BFR) microsphere surface show good stability. AuNPs/BFR microspheres not only favor the immobilization of antibody but also facilitate the electron transfer. It is found that the resultant AuNPs/BFR microspheres can be designed to act as a sensitive label-free electrochemical immunosensor for carcinoembryonic antigen (CEA) determination. The immunosensor is prepared by immobilizing capture anti-CEA on AuNPs/BFR microspheres assembled on thionine (TH) modified glassy carbon electrode (GCE). TH acts as the redox probe. Under the optimized conditions, the linear range of the proposed immunosensor is estimated to be from 25 pg/mL to 2000 pg/mL (R=0.998) and the detection limit is estimated to be 3.5 pg/mL at a signal-to-noise ratio of 3. The prepared immunosensor for detection of CEA shows high sensitivity, reproducibility and stability. Our study demonstrates that the immunosensor can be used for the CEA detection in humans serum.
